3.0MAJOR COMPONENTS

The Liebert GXT2-PP20KRT208 has five main components (see Figure 4):

UPS input / output circuit breakers

Main input / output terminal blocks

Parallel communication ports

Maintenance bypass breaker

Input and output slots for each UPS

3.1Input and Output Slots for UPS

The parallel POD is shipped with three input/output slots for hardwire connections with the UPSs. The eight-pole connector with color coding and keying are used for the interconnecting wires between UPS input and output. The UPS connector will snap into the connector of the parallel POD only in the correct direction and only with the same color.

3.2Main Input / Output Terminal Blocks

Hardwire terminal blocks are at the top left corner on the front side of the parallel POD. Input and output wiring should not share the same conduit. See the requirements and label in 5.3 - Main Input and Output Terminal Block Connections to connect the wires.

3.3Maintenance Bypass Breaker

The Maintenance Bypass Breaker allows the user to transfer the load to utility to remove a UPS from the paralleling system for maintenance without shutting off power to the load (see 8.1.2 - Bypass Mode) for the transfer procedure). For further information on the UPS Maintenance Bypass Breaker, refer to the Liebert GXT2-10000RT208 user manual, SL-23444, available at the Liebert Web site, www.liebert.com

3.4UPS Input / Output Circuit Breakers

The Liebert GXT2-PP20KRT208 is equipped with six circuit breakers (three input breakers and three output breakers). During normal operation in the paralleling system, input/output circuit breakers are in the On position. When installing or removing a UPS, the corresponding breakers should be switched to the Off position.
